Natural Resources & Conservation is the 25th most popular major in the country with 30,503 degrees awarded in 2020-2021. In 2019-2020, natural resources and conservation gra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$35,158 and had an average of $23,267 in loans still to pay off.

Across South Carolina, there were 255 natural resources and conservation graduates with average earnings and debt of $36,513 and $22,250 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 136 natural resources and conservation graduates with average earnings and debt of $35,293 and $28,603 respectively.

This year’s “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Natural Resources & Conservation Major in South Carolina” ranking analyzed 9 colleges that offered a degree in natural resources and conservation. The colleges and universities that top this list are recognized because their natural resources and conservation program is one of the largest majors offered at the school.
